GAME Black Friday deals: When do GAME deals go live?

Britons are getting ready for one of the biggest shopping days of the year as Black Friday is this Friday, November 23. However, retailers have already started preparing for the big day as shoppers can enjoy early offers ahead of the sales bonanza. Here is a guide to GAME’s 2018 Black Friday deals.

When do GAME deals go live?

The GAME deals will go live on November 22 at 6pm both in-store and online.

This means the deals will start one day before the actual Black Friday.

According to GAME, they are “well underway” prepping their best deals, including offers on PS4, XBOX One and Switch.

However, GAME is also doing an early Black Friday sale, and these prices won’t get cheaper on Black Friday.
